  • What is fish bone made of?

    The skeleton of the fish is made of either cartilage (cartilaginous fishes) or bone (bony fishes). The fins are made up of bony fin rays and, except for the caudal fin, have no direct connection with the spine. They are supported only by the muscles. The ribs attach to the spine.

  • Is the black part of tuna edible?

    That dark, nearly black area in the middle of your tuna or swordfish steak is nothing bad or unhealthy, although you may not like its strong flavor. ... You can leave it in when you cook the fish: the stronger flavor of that one area will not affect the rest of the fish.

  • What size hook is best for kingfish?

    Hook sizes are typically 7/0 to 12/0, depending on bait size. Livebait patterns are perfect for livebaiting, but any strong short-shank hook, including circle hooks, is fine. Overhead or good quality spinning reels with the line capacity and drag performance to handle kingfish can be used.

  • How deadly is a pistol shrimp?

    Despite being less than an inch long, the creatures can emit an astonishing 218 decibels - louder than a gunshot. The sound stuns small fish and crabs, allowing the shrimp to move in for the kill.

  • What are tiger barbs favorite food?

    Live brine shrimp and blood worms are tiger barb favorites when it comes to live foods. A live food diet is especially important during breeding time, when protein-rich foods are required to induce spawning.

  • What fish can live in a dirty pond?

    Fish that clean ponds by eating algae and other debris include the common pleco, the mosquitofish, the Siamese algae eater and the grass carp. Be careful with carp, koi and other bottom feeders. While they eat algae, they can also make your pond look dirty.

  • Are crayfish harmful?

    Crayfish are detrimental to the ecosystem of the Santa Monica Mountains because they: Prey on native species which drive native populations down, such as the Arroyo Chub, California Newt, California Tree Frog, Baja California Tree Frog, and the Southern California Steelhead Trout.
